The cancellation of the vast majority of flights to and from the Isle of Man today (Friday) has led to the postponement of this weekend's third Consular Outreach programme for the local Filipino community.
The initiative gives Filipinos living on the Island a chance to discuss problems and sort out various issues with the Consul General from London, Maria Theresa Dizon de Vega.
It had been due to take place at the Manx Legion Club, on Market Hill in Douglas, on Saturday and Sunday.
The Filipino ambassador to the United Kingdom had been due to make his first visit to the Isle of Man, to coincide with the Outreach event.
Both visits will now be rearranged, for a date to be confirmed.
The Filipino community variety concert at Sulby Village Hall this weekend will go ahead as planned.
